Healthy Neighborhood
Reference Number: 02/2019
With this call for tender of the "Healthy Neighborhood", the aim of the Vienna Health Promotion is to enhance social cohesion in the Neighborhood and Psychosocial settings To promote the health of the inhabitants, in concrete terms, this should be done through theDevelopment of social relationships in the sense of social capital theory, as well as on the design of the respective neighborhood to a health-promoting habitat done. Primary target groups are children, families and older people in the sense of an intergenerational approach with special consideration of the socio-economically disadvantaged persons or groups of people. taskTenderers are invited to offer two different ways of reaching their goals. The actual decision in which district of which of the proposed solutions will be implemented will follow the tendering process (expected September 2019).
